If you haven't heard, there is a new lawsuit against the Payette and Boise National Forest in Idaho and the Bridger-Teton National Forest of Wyoming over their existing winter travel plan decisions.
There is an article pertaining to the Idaho portions of this lawsuit that can be found in the "NEWS" button in the header of this web page. I have also attached a file that contains this article.
This is one lawsuit that encompasses 3 different National Forests, in Idaho and Wyoming. Whoever fights for one, fights for all three.
Not sure what the BRC Blue Ribbon Coalition or the WSSA Wyoming State Snowmobile Association is going to do, or even if they are aware of this.

Colorado Snowmobilers Helping Idaho Snowmobilers

The Colorado Snowmobile Association (CSA)has pledged up to $5000 match to challenge it's members to donate funds to the ISSA (Idaho State Snowmobile Association) for it's legal fund. The pending lawsuit from WWA (Winter Wildland Alliance) is going to be on the backs of the snowmobilers to defend ourselves and defeat it.
Let us all stand tall and do our part in this effort. Whatever happens here will have a ripple affect throughout the USFS winter travel decisions.
